Prime Video is set to deliver high-stakes with G20, premiering on April 10, 2025. Produced by Amazon Studios and MRC Film, the political action thriller features Davis as U.S. President Danielle Sutton, who finds herself at the center of a “situation” when the G20 summit comes under siege. As the world’s most powerful leaders gather to address global challenges, President Sutton must navigate a treacherous landscape of danger and deception, evading capture and outsmarting the enemy to protect not only her family but also her country and fellow world leaders.

Directed by Patricia Riggen
(in what appears to be her big budget action debut)
Starring Viola Davis, Anthony Anderson, Marsai Martin, Ramón Rodríguez, Douglas Hodge, Elizabeth Marvel, Sabrina Impacciatore, Christopher Farrar, and Antony Starr
Written by Caitlin Parrish & Erica Weiss and Logan Miller & Noah Miller
Story by Logan Miller & Noah Miller
G20 streams globally on Prime Video April 10
